Euphorbia tirucalli - sometimes known as Sticks of Fire, is a striking and architecturally interesting small, succulent shrub with pencil thin branches that turn to strong shades of orange and red over the cooler months of the year.
These very unusual plants are easy to keep and go well in pots as a patio feature or can be planted en-masse for example as a low hedge.
They grow as a thicket and are particularly colourful over winter.
There are leaves that appear but they soon drop off.
This plant is particularly useful in dry and gravel gardens, coastal settings, and Mediterranean style gardens.
